cancel
Showing results for 
Search instead for 
Did you mean: 

com.sapportals.portal.appintegrator.ApplicationIntegratorException

Former Member
0 Kudos

Hi All ,

I am getting following exception for a user

Content pass of Application Integrator failed.

Component Name: com.sap.portal.appintegrator.sap.WebDynpro,

Context Name (iView): pcd:portal_content/com.adc.root/hrtool/com.adc.hrtool.roles_hrtool/com.adc.hrtool.hrtool_rl/com.sap.pct.erp.hradmin.HRAdministrator/ECF/com.adc.hr.ess.poc.pcf.request.PCFRequest_0,

Top Layer: WebDynpro/TopLayer,

Producer ID (FPN): null,

System Alias: SAP_R3,

[EXCEPTION]

com.sapportals.portal.appintegrator.ApplicationIntegratorException: Cannot retrieve system object for this alias.

System Alias: 'SAP_R3',

System ID: 'pcd:portal_content/com.adc.root/systems/sap_r3'.

User: '00039883',

Reason: Access denied (Object(s): portal_content/com.adc.root/systems/sap_r3)

at com.sapportals.portal.appintegrator.accessor.system.LocalSystemAccessor.<init>(LocalSystemAccessor.java:84)

at com.sapportals.portal.appintegrator.accessor.system.LocalSystemAccessor.getInstance(LocalSystemAccessor.java:112)

at com.sapportals.portal.appintegrator.accessor.system.SystemAccessorFactory.getSystemAccessor(SystemAccessorFactory.java:52)

at com.sapportals.portal.appintegrator.layer.AbstractIntegrationLayer.getLocalOrRemote(AbstractIntegrationLayer.java:512)

at com.sapportals.portal.appintegrator.layer.TopLayerSwitch.mustRedirectToProducer(TopLayerSwitch.java:85)

at com.sapportals.portal.appintegrator.layer.TopLayerSwitch.getNextLayer(TopLayerSwitch.java:64)

at com.sapportals.portal.appintegrator.LayerProcessor.getNextLayer(LayerProcessor.java:259)

at com.sapportals.portal.appintegrator.LayerProcessor.processActionPass(LayerProcessor.java:167)

at com.sapportals.portal.appintegrator.AbstractIntegratorComponent.doActionPass(AbstractIntegratorComponent.java:68)

at com.sapportals.portal.appintegrator.AbstractIntegratorComponent.doOnPOMReady(AbstractIntegratorComponent.java:54)

at com.sapportals.portal.prt.component.AbstractPortalComponent.handleEvent(AbstractPortalComponent.java:396)

at com.sapportals.portal.prt.pom.ComponentNode.handleEvent(ComponentNode.java:252)

at com.sapportals.portal.prt.pom.PortalNode.fireEventOnNode(PortalNode.java:368)

at com.sapportals.portal.prt.pom.PortalNode.processEventQueue(PortalNode.java:799)

at com.sapportals.portal.prt.core.PortalRequestManager.runRequestCycle(PortalRequestManager.java:652)

at com.sapportals.portal.prt.connection.ServletConnection.handleRequest(ServletConnection.java:240)

at com.sapportals.portal.prt.dispatcher.Dispatcher$doService.run(Dispatcher.java:524)

at java.security.AccessController.doPrivileged(Native Method)

at com.sapportals.portal.prt.dispatcher.Dispatcher.service(Dispatcher.java:407)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)

at com.sap.engine.services.servlets_jsp.server.servlet.InvokerServlet.service(InvokerServlet.java:156)

at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.runServlet(HttpHandlerImpl.java:401)

at com.sap.engine.services.servlets_jsp.server.HttpHandlerImpl.handleRequest(HttpHandlerImpl.java:266)

at com.sap.engine.services.httpserver.server.RequestAnalizer.startServlet(RequestAnalizer.java:387)

at com.sap.engine.services.httpserver.server.RequestAnalizer.startServlet(RequestAnalizer.java:365)

at com.sap.engine.services.httpserver.server.RequestAnalizer.invokeWebContainer(RequestAnalizer.java:944)

at com.sap.engine.services.httpserver.server.RequestAnalizer.handle(RequestAnalizer.java:266)

at com.sap.engine.services.httpserver.server.Client.handle(Client.java:95)

at com.sap.engine.services.httpserver.server.Processor.request(Processor.java:175)

at com.sap.engine.core.service630.context.cluster.session.ApplicationSessionMessageListener.process(ApplicationSessionMessageListener.java:33)

at com.sap.engine.core.cluster.impl6.session.MessageRunner.run(MessageRunner.java:41)

at com.sap.engine.core.thread.impl3.ActionObject.run(ActionObject.java:37)

at java.security.AccessController.doPrivileged(Native Method)

at com.sap.engine.core.thread.impl3.SingleThread.execute(SingleThread.java:100)

at com.sap.engine.core.thread.impl3.SingleThread.run(SingleThread.java:170)

Caused by: com.sapportals.portal.pcd.gl.PermissionControlException: Access denied (Object(s): portal_content/com.adc.root/systems/sap_r3)

at com.sapportals.portal.pcd.gl.PcdFilterContext.filterLookup(PcdFilterContext.java:422)

at com.sapportals.portal.pcd.gl.PcdProxyContext.basicContextLookup(PcdProxyContext.java:1248)

at com.sapportals.portal.pcd.gl.PcdProxyContext.basicContextLookup(PcdProxyContext.java:1254)

at com.sapportals.portal.pcd.gl.PcdProxyContext.basicContextLookup(PcdProxyContext.java:1254)

at com.sapportals.portal.pcd.gl.PcdProxyContext.basicContextLookup(PcdProxyContext.java:1254)

at com.sapportals.portal.pcd.gl.PcdProxyContext.proxyLookupLink(PcdProxyContext.java:1353)

at com.sapportals.portal.pcd.gl.PcdProxyContext.proxyLookup(PcdProxyContext.java:1300)

at com.sapportals.portal.pcd.gl.PcdProxyContext.lookup(PcdProxyContext.java:1067)

at com.sapportals.portal.pcd.gl.PcdGlContext.lookup(PcdGlContext.java:68)

at com.sapportals.portal.pcd.gl.PcdURLContext.lookup(PcdURLContext.java:238)

at javax.naming.InitialContext.lookup(InitialContext.java:347)

at com.sapportals.portal.appintegrator.accessor.system.LocalSystemAccessor.<init>(LocalSystemAccessor.java:81)

Please help me in resolving this issue , you help would be 200% rewarded

Accepted Solutions (0)

Answers (3)

Answers (3)

Former Member
0 Kudos

I have checked it , those are also fine. Is there something becuase https port?

Former Member
0 Kudos

Hi,

test the system object connection

System administration > system configuration > system landscape

Then i untre the portal content , find my folder and then find the system defined inside that folder and then from the context menu (The menu that comes after right clicking ) of that system i choose "connection tests" . This opens up the connection test options on the right hand side of the portal . Among the given options I choose the option which says

"Connection test for connectors" .

if you get any error....check each property once again and check the port no also

Koti Reddy

Former Member
0 Kudos

Hi.

Please Re-Check the permission configuration. Permission denied is permission denied.

It's rarely the case that an error message is more obvious than a "Caused by: com.sapportals.portal.pcd.gl.PermissionControlException: Access denied (Object(s): portal_content/com.adc.root/systems/sap_r3)".

Cheerrs, Karsten

Former Member
0 Kudos

Hi guys,

I had similar problem. Solution was to check permisions of my connection. Now it works fine.

Jiri.

Former Member
0 Kudos

Hi

I have checked the configuration of Permission , it seems to be ok. What should be my next step.

Former Member
0 Kudos

Hi,

check the system object properties

Koti Reddy

pramod_gopisetty1
Active Contributor
0 Kudos

Hello,

1. Have you checked the System Alias. Is it existing? to see go to System Administration - System Configuration and check the existence of system.

2. Right click on that and go to permissions and check whether end-user permission is assigned to it or not.

3. In Content Administration go to HR Admin folder and check whether end-user permission is assigned or not?

update after you had a look at these settings.

Hope this helps.

Cheers-

Pramod